Abstract
To operate with high efficiency and minimise the risks of power failures, power systems require careful monitoring. The availability of real-time data is crucial for assessing the performance of the grid and assisting operators in gauging the present security of the grid. Traditional supervisory control and data acquisition (SCADA)-based systems actually employed provides steady-state measurement values which are the calculation premise of State Estimation. More often, however, the power grid operates under dynamic state and SCADA measurements can lead to erroneous and inaccurate calculation results. The introduction of the phasor measurement unit (PMU) which provides real-time synchronised voltage and current phasors with very high accuracy is universally recognised as an important aspect of delivering a secure and sustainable power system. PMUs are a relatively new technology and because of their high procurement and installation costs, it is imperative to develop appropriate methodologies to determine the minimum number of PMUs as well as their strategic placements to guarantee full observability of a power system. Thus, the problem of the optimal PMU placement (OPP) is formulated as an optimisation problem subject to various constraints to minimise the number of PMUs while ensuring complete observability of the grid. In this chapter, integer linear programming (ILP), genetic algorithm (GA) and non-linear programming (NLP) constrained models of the OPP problem are presented. A new methodology is proposed to incorporate several constraints using the NLP. The optimisation methods have been written in Matlab software and verified on the standard Institute of Electrical and Electronics Engineers (IEEE) 14-bus test system to authenticate their effectiveness. This chapter targets United Nations Sustainable Development Goal 7.

Abstract
Estimation of (in)efficiency became a popular practice that witnessed applications in virtually any sector of the economy over the last few decades. Many different models were deployed for such endeavors, with Stochastic Frontier Analysis (SFA) models dominating the econometric literature. Among the most popular variants of SFA are Aigner, Lovell, and Schmidt (1977), which launched the literature, and Kumbhakar, Ghosh, and McGuckin (1991), which pioneered the branch taking account of the (in)efficiency term via the so-called environmental variables or determinants of inefficiency. Focusing on these two prominent approaches in SFA, the goal of this chapter is to try to understand the production inefficiency of public hospitals in Queensland. While doing so, a recognized yet often overlooked phenomenon emerges where possible dramatic differences (and consequently very different policy implications) can be derived from different models, even within one paradigm of SFA models. This emphasizes the importance of exploring many alternative models, and scrutinizing their assumptions, before drawing policy implications, especially when such implications may substantially affect people’s lives, as is the case in the hospital sector.

Abstract
With 43.2 million coronavirus cases and 525,000 deaths in 2022, India ranked second worldwide, after the United States (84.6 million cases and 1 million deaths), according to the latest available June 2022 COVID-19 impact data.
Amid people’s growing mistrust in the government, India’s news media enhanced the nation’s distinguished designation as the world’s largest and most populous democracy. India’s news media inform, educate, empower, and entertain a surging population of 1.4 billion people, which is roughly one-sixth of the world’s people.
Drawing upon the media agendamelding theoretical framework, we conducted a case study research into interplay between two prominent democratic institutions, the media and the government, to analyze the role of the COVID-19 pandemic in redefining India’s networked society.
India’s COVID-19 pandemic aggravated internecine tensions between media and government relating to four key freedom issues: (1) world’s largest COVID-19 lockdown affecting 1.3 billion Indians from March 25, 2020 to August 2020 with extensions and five-phased re-openings, to restrict the spread of COVID-19; (2) Internet shutdowns; (3) media censorship during the 1975–1977 “Emergency”; and (4) unabated murders of journalists in India.
Although the COVID-19 pandemic caused deleterious problems debilitating the tensions between the media and the government, India’s journalists thrived by speaking truth to power. This study delineates key aspects of India’s media agendamelding that explicates how the people of India form their media agendas. India’s news audiences meld media messages from newspapers, television, and social media to form a picture of the issues, insights, and ideas that define their lives and times in the 21st century digital age.

Abstract
Engaging with digital heritage requires understanding not only to comprehend what is simulated but also the reasons leading to its creation and curation, and how to ensure both the digital media and the significance of the cultural heritage it portrays are passed on effectively, meaningfully, and appropriately. The United Nations Educational, Scientific, and Cultural Organization defines ‘digital heritage’ to comprise of computer-based materials of enduring value some of which require active preservation strategies to maintain them for years to come.
With the proliferation of digital technologies and digital media, computer games have increasingly been seen as not only depicters of cultural heritage and platforms for virtual heritage scholarship and dissemination but also as digital cultural artefacts worthy of preservation. In this chapter, we examine how games (both digital and non-digital) can communicate cultural heritage in a galleries, libraries, archives, and museums [GLAM] setting. We also consider how they can and have been used to explore, communicate, and preserve heritage and, in particular, Indigenous heritage. Despite their apparently transient and ephemeral nature, especially compared to conventional media such as books, we argue computer games can be incorporated into active preservation approaches to digital heritage. Indeed, they may be of value to cultural heritage that needs to be not only viewed but also viscerally experienced or otherwise performed.

Abstract
Chapter Summary
The rapid evolution of curation practices today is a response to expanded access to information and knowledge and the dynamic development of intelligent technologies well suited to curatorial practices. This chapter provides an overview of traditional curation theory and practice. It identifies its historical origins of anthropology, ethnography, museum work, and archival practices. The authors note that traditional curatorial practices have been a subset of preservation practices. Today it draws heavily from traditional practices but expands the goal and purpose beyond simple preservation to storytelling, learning, creating new perspectives, interpreting the past and present, and creating new business knowledge. The chapter lays out the emerging spectrum of curation purposes and practices. The widespread access to curatorial tools now opens curatorial work to the general public. More comprehensive access argues for a broader dialog around the new competencies and capabilities these new practices require.

Abstract
Purpose: This chapter explores the two major schemes applicable to skill development in India: Skill Acquisition and Knowledge Awareness for Livelihood Promotion (SANKALP) and Pradhan Mantri Kaushal Vikas Yojana (PMKVY).
Need for the Study: The primary objective of this research is to check the role of these schemes in enhancing the skills of socio-economically stressed community members for their livelihoods. The secondary aim is to analyse the outcomes of these schemes through a qualitative inquiry.
Methodology: A survey was conducted, and the data was collected from trainees of the skill development programmes. Based on the responses, a qualitative content analysis was performed, which showed that most trainees have the thirst and urge to enhance their life skills for a minimalistic livelihood.
Findings: The study concluded that though there are many schemes, only PMKVY is active. They focus on more than just youth communities. Instead, they consider individuals in different age categories.
Practical Implications: The Government of India (GOI) is progressing towards a healthy economy to compete with other countries. For this mission to be achieved, skill and labour development is paramount. Appropriate training must be provided and administrated through government schemes.
